Job Description

PA0186 Mount Joy **Job Description** The C & I Commercial Relationship Manager III is responsible for serving as a trusted business advisor to clients and provide a full breadth of banking solutions to meeting their financial objectives and needs while establishing a network of referral sources and Centers of Influence with regular calling efforts to generate new business opportunities. The C & I Commercial Relationship Manager III is also responsible for managing a portfolio of relationships, ensuring an exceptional client experience, while appropriately managing risk, credit quality, servicing, etc. in accordance with Northwest standards and in partnership with a portfolio management team. **Essential Functions** * Develop and expand existing commercial banking relationships * Prospect actively and successfully bring in new relationships to Northwest * Engage with the various product partners on a regular basis to discuss cross selling opportunities and referrals to expand and deepen client relationships * Achieve and exceed budget goals as assigned individually and by region * Actively participate in community and professional networking events * Develop meaningful “Centers of Influence” relationships * Establish and maintain an ongoing prospect list, and a set calling and meeting schedule for prospects, existing clients, and COIs * Encourage existing clients to provide ongoing referrals for all types of products and services, and clients and their employees to maintain their personal banking at Northwest * Manage a commercial loan portfolio of both credit and noncredit clients * Make loan presentations and recommendations to Credit, team leaders, and senior line of business managers as required * Partner with credit and portfolio management to ensure annual reviews and line of credit renewals are completed on a timely basis * Ensure noncredit clients have appropriate treasury management and other related commercial services, and risk ratings are appropriate * As required, collect on delinquent accounts * Analyze financial statements and related credit material to stay apprised of client performance and assess risk on a continuous basis in conjunction with Portfolio Management * Complete loan closings in partnership with Portfolio Management * Ensure all credit files include current financial statements, agency reports, etc. in partnership with Portfolio Management * Participate in continued sales, product and credit training * Ensure compliance with Northwest’s policies and procedures, and Federal/State regulations * Navigate Microsoft Office Software, computer applications, and software specific to the department in order to maximize technology tools and gain efficiency * Work as part of a team * Work with on-site equipment . * Complete special projects as assigned **Education:** * Bachelor's degree in Business, Accounting, Finance, Economics, or Marketing preferred **Work History:** * 6 - 8 years account relationship management experience preferred * 6 - 8 years experience consistently delivering strong sales performance preferred #LI-EK1 Northwest is an equal opportunity employer.
